All Rights Reserved. 4 Front Office Practice Assignment How to Schedule an Appointment 1. Within the weekly calendar, click on a time slot to open the New Appointment window. 2. Select the Patient Visit radio button as the Appointment Type. 3. Select New patient visit from the Visit Type dropdown. 4. Document “Recurring mild chest pains” in the Chief Complaint text box. 5. Select the Search Existing Patients radio button. 6. Using the Patient Search fields, search for Wright, Henry in the patient database. Searching for a patient record confirms that patient does not already exist within the system. 7. Helpful Hint: Confirming a patient’s date of birth will help to ensure that you have located the correct patient record. 8. Select Cancel to return to the New Appointment overlay. 9. Select the Create New Patient radio button. 10. Document Mr. Wright’s demographics, provider and insurance information from the Assignment Description. 11. Click Save. 12. Select an exam room for the patient’s appointment using the Exam Room dropdown. 13. Confirm the correct appointment date or use the calendar picker to select the correct date. 14. Select a start and end time for the appointment using the Start Time and End Time dropdowns. 15. Type “New patient.” in the Description text field. 16. Click the Save button. A confirmation message will appear. 17. Click the OK button to proceed. 18. Mr. Wright’s appointment will be displayed on the calendar. Copyright © 2014 by Elsevier Inc. All Rights Reserved. 6 Clinical Care Practice Assignment Document Vital Signs, Allergies and Medications for Henry Wright Assignment Objectives Search for a patient record. Create an encounter. Document Vital Signs. Document Allergies. Document Medications. Competencies • Execute data management using electronic healthcare records such as the EMR, ABHES 7-b.2, CAAHEP V.P-5 • Document accurately in the patient record, CAAHEP IX.P-7 • Document patient care, CAAHEP IV.P-8 • Organize a patient’s medical record, ABHES 8-b/CAAHEP V.P-3 • Maintain medication and immunization records, ABHES 9-g Assignment Description Henry Wright has arrived at the clinic for his first appointment with Dr. Martin. Mr. Wright is a heavy smoker who exercises 1-2 times a week. He states that he feels his mild chest pains occur most often during the late afternoon and evening before bed. He believes the pain to be heartburn but it is concerned it might be due to worsening high blood pressure. He takes a Lisinopril 5 mg po QD for hypertension. His vital signs are measured as T: 98.5°F (TA), P: 85 reg, strong radial, R: 14 reg, BP: 170/90 left arm, sitting. Mr. Wright also states that he has a mild food allergy to peanuts with hives and itching. Create a New Patient Encounter for Mr. Wright and document his vital signs, allergies and medications in the patient record. All Rights Reserved. 10 Coding & Billing Practice Assignment Post charges to the Superbill, Ledger, and Complete Claim for Henry Wright Assignment Objectives Search for a patient record. Complete a Superbill . Update a patient ledger. Complete a claim. Competencies • Utilize computerized office billing systems, ABHES 8-w/CAAHEP • Document accurately in the patient record, ABHES 4-a/CAAHEP IX.9-7 • Complete insurance claim forms, ABHES 8-u/CAAHEP VII.P-3 Assignment Description Henry Wright has completed his visit with the physician and now the billing procedures need to be done. The physician indicated that this was a new patient, detailed office with a diagnosis of hypertension (ICD-9 401.1, ICD-10 I10). Complete the Superbill using the fee schedule to determine the correct CPT code and charge amount for this visit. Complete the Ledger using the information from the Superbill. Complete the Claim using the information from the Ledger. Copyright © 2014 by Elsevier Inc.
